Output 94deaebc62b4496eee64ac0f59e2965017c93336a41d0fa9203f39222aa9b816:0

value
2007074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d306af711ddf05e03ad76521b5bb12c16b058a2 OP_EQUAL
address
35oxLJhydVtKucJaG7H9CRfLoXJWHLfZyg
transaction
94deaebc62b4496eee64ac0f59e2965017c93336a41d0fa9203f39222aa9b816
confirmations
391714
spent
true